Docker安装drools workbench和kie-server,使用http调用kie-server rest接口传json参数跑规则
尝试使用docker安装了drools workbench和kie-server,非常方便,记录如下。
https://hub.docker.com/r/jboss/drools-workbench-showcase
1 2
|
docker pull jboss/drools-workbench-showcase docker run -p 8080:8080 -p 8001:8001 -d --name drools-workbench jboss/drools-workbench-showcase:latest
|
启动成功后,访问
http://ip:port/business-central
即可,默认用户名密码见上面的链接
https://hub.docker.com/r/jboss/kie-server-showcase
1 2
|
docker pull jboss/kie-server-showcase docker run -p 8180:8080 -d --name kie-server --link drools-workbench:kie_wb jboss/kie-server-showcase:latest
|
默认的用户名密码是
kieserver/kieserver1!
注意
docker hub 上的启动命令
--link drools-wb:kie-wb
实操后发现无法连接上workbench,在workbench页面上找不到启动的kie-server,修改伟
--link drools-wb:kie_wb
后链接成功。原因暂时没找到…